Transaction 7a73e954e59abb068a712a1440366febd3e7f89c2bf175db77ee181e87dba74d

1 Input
2 Outputs
  • 7a73e954e59abb068a712a1440366febd3e7f89c2bf175db77ee181e87dba74d:0
  • value  2567100
    address  3DKqNnLqXBZX8jfegZxebvsBMYsfPyyaSd
  • 7a73e954e59abb068a712a1440366febd3e7f89c2bf175db77ee181e87dba74d:1
  • value  68210298
    address  1CCXBKzqmN7mfjfxVDUJGubpPUo1oWgP6e